Flyway script example

WebNov 12, 2024 · The first job is to create two empty copies of the Pubs database and then migrate each one so that they are both at V1.1.10. You can use the UndoBuild.ps1 script to run the migrations on each database. We choose one of these copies to add the data to the new tables and connect to it from SQL Data Generator. WebAug 28, 2024 · 3 Answers. 1- Make sure that your hibernate DDL generation is disabled: 2- Make sure that the name of your SQL migration script respects flyway's convention. i.e. Flyway has not found any migrations, and Hibernate has then created the tables from your entities. This is the default so could be omitted.

Flyway - Squashing Migrations - Medium

WebDec 23, 2024 · 6. Try to apply the same script again — flyway will recognize the database version remains unchanged. Just run again. mvn clean flyway:migrate -Dflyway.configFile=myFlywayConfig.properties WebSpring Boot example with Flyway for DB migration. DB migration can be done using flyway db under the hood by providing some configuration details and migration script. ... To identify scripts status flyway uses … notpetya schaden https://gpstechnologysolutions.com

Flyway by Redgate • Database Migrations Made Easy.

WebMar 21, 2024 · Our development team is currently hard at work improving the advanced capabilities in Flyway, such as allowing database developers to maintains a version … WebApr 28, 2024 · Let's use Flyway to create the table and populate it. Creating a Flyway Script. To create our customer table, and populate it with a few records, we will create a … WebJan 22, 2024 · Flyway connects to a database via Java Database Connectivity (JDBC) drivers. Flyway uses a naming convention to determine whether the file is a versioned migration script rather than an undo or repeatable migration, what version the database will be if the script executes successfully, and its description. The suffix defaults to SQL. how to shave ur but

Database Versioning with Flyway and Java - Auth0

Category:Flyway: How to create a SQL Server database before flyway …

Tags:Flyway script example

Flyway script example

org.flywaydb.core.api.MigrationInfo Java Examples

WebThis example uses Flyway to create and update the required database schema (see the common/database Maven module). This module includes the database scripts for ALL components (even though this example repo only includes a single component named check-engine). That means all components would share a single database schema, but … WebJun 30, 2024 · Flyway is very easy to configure. All you need to do is instantiate the org.flywaydb.core.Flyway class and set the JDBC DataSource and the location of the database migration scripts. If you’re using Spring Framework, then you can use the following Java-based configuration: 1. 2. 3.

Flyway script example

Did you know?

WebAny Oracle SQL script executed by Flyway can be executed by SQL*Plus and other Oracle-compatible tools (after the placeholders have been replaced) ... to Flyway. For example, in flyway.conf: flyway.oracle.kerberosConfigFile = /etc/krb5.conf flyway.oracle.kerberosCacheFile = /tmp/krb5cc_123. Proxy Authentication. Flyway … WebNov 14, 2024 · Migration scripts can be written in either SQL or Java. Spring Boot can autorun database migration at the application startup with a variety of mechanisms such …

WebWhat is Flyway and how does it work? Flyway is an open-source tool, licensed under Apache License 2.0, that helps you implement automated and version-based database migrations. It allows you to define the required update operations in an SQL script or as Java code. You can then run the migration from a command line client or automatically … WebTutorial: Java-based Migrations. This tutorial assumes you have successfully completed the First Steps: Maven tutorial. If you have not done so, please do so first. This tutorial picks up where that one left off.

WebJul 15, 2024 · Flyway will then just use the default location (db/migration), which will find only the V1.1__Insert_Records.sql script but not the V1__Create_table.sql script. With Spring Boot 2.x, flyway.locations must be prefixed with spring. WebAug 25, 2024 · A real-life example: for my current project, my SQL scripts are currently contained in the same repo as my API, so the deployment strategy is to spin up the …

WebFor example V1__execute_batch_tool.ps1 is a valid migration. Script migrations can be used for a number of tasks such as: Triggering execution of a 3rd party application as …

WebSep 29, 2016 · In this tutorial, we'll explore key concepts of Flyway and how we can use this framework to continuously remodel our application's database schema reliably and … how to shave upper armsWebTo achieve migrations, Flyway uses so-called migration scripts. Migrations scripts are "sequentially ordered SQL scripts" that incrementally migrate your schema. In order to recognize migration scripts, Flyway relies on naming conventions ... An example of migration script folder could be: how to shave upper lipWebSep 11, 2024 · Flyway will look in its configured locations(s) for SQL callback files and execute them accordingly. As an example, a file named beforeEachMigrate.sql in a … how to shave ur coochieWebApr 12, 2024 · Flyway Desktop Baseline – A script that has the structure and code of all objects that exist in the target database (s). We can create a baseline script for Flyway, which looks for a B script, but the baseline command expects that you create this script manually. This is used to populate a new database with the baseline migration script … notpetya wppWebflyway-commandline-6.4.2-windows-x64.zip. Flyway 是一款开源的数据库版本管理工具,它更倾向于规约优于配置的方式。. Flyway 可以独立于应用实现管理并跟踪数据库变更,支持数据库版本自动升级,并且有一套默认的规约,不需要复杂的配置,Migrations 可以写成 … notpit securityWebJan 27, 2024 · We’ll start off by using Flyway to run a build process, supplying a build script for every version. Therefore, the PubsFlywayBuild directory has in its Scripts directory two build scripts, one that builds a … notpetya malware attackWebDec 1, 2024 · Each migration script is run within a single transaction. However, you can configure all migrations in a single script by setting the spring.flyway.group=true property in the application.properties file. The … notpla earth shot prize